If elemental tortoise stacks with the max resistance, than you should be able to easily go over 100%, but so far I don't know, if it does. Haven't played that far yet. Or you can go with avatar of fire, wich gives additional 25% resistance if those stack with the max.
In the patch notes it said:
- Max resistance of player chars was capped to 80%, this is now 100%
Am I understanding it wrong?
But they also made it harder to get high resistances even with man-at-arms, so can't tell how easily 100% are achievable in late game.
Nope.
I have a fire mage with 96% base resist (for using explode).
What has changed is that having >100% (via chilled) no longer heals you. Annoying, I was trying to use frozen / heat etc to make a char who could port into the middle of combat and AoE.
